#9f68b4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#9f68b4 is composed of 62.4% red, 40.8%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.7% cyan, 42.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 283.4 degrees, a saturation of 33.6% and a lightness of 55.7%. #9f68b4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d0ff with #3f0069. Closest websafe color is: #9966cc.

Shades and Tints of #9f68b4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050306 is the darkest color, while #fbf8f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#9f68b4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8f8b91 is the less saturated color, while #be22fa is the most saturated one.
